    U.S. Marines assigned to Maritime Raid Force, 13th Marine Expeditionary Unit, prepare to board a simulated vessel of interest during visit, board, search and seizure training off the coast of California, July 25, 2026. This advanced VBSS capability provided by the MRF gives the 13th MEU an organic, combat credible element able to support larger Amphibious Ready Group/MEU Maritime Interdiction Operation capabilities. The 13th MEU and the Makin Island Amphibious Ready Group are underway and conducting routine operations in the U.S. 3rd Fleet area of operations to enhance their combined Navy-Marine Corps readiness and lethality.
